| | Language at Logon Screen Hi, I am using Windows Vista, during windows registration i put errornusly put wrong language and now when i start computer i have to change language before i type password. someone please let me know how i solve this issue. thanks. |

| | Re: Language at Logon Screen Hello, I believe this will help: Start > Control Panel > type: language (into search box in the upper right of the window) > click: Regional and Language Options . There, change everything to the needed, and then go to the tab "Administrative" and press * Copy to reserved accounts... Quote: > Follow the options. -- Greetings, P.
